Golf Club de Saint Méard de Gurçon, also known as Montravel Golf Club, is a 9-hole course located in the Périgord Pourpre region of southwestern France, positioned on elevated terrain between Saint-Émilion and Bergerac. The course is situated in the Pays de Montaigne et Gurçon area, offering a natural setting that takes advantage of the local landscape and topography.

The club welcomes golfers of all levels, from beginners to experienced players, with a focus on accessibility and inclusivity. The course is designed to provide a recreational sporting experience in a natural environment, emphasizing a friendly and family-oriented atmosphere. The layout accommodates various skill levels, with regular competitions organized throughout the year for all playing abilities.

The course operates year-round, with extended hours during peak season (8:30 AM to 7:00 PM) and reduced hours during off-season (9:00 AM to 5:30 PM).
